The hydraulic press industry is undergoing a digital and ecological transformation. The roadmap for Jiangdong Machinery's heavy-duty extrusion systems focuses on three core pillars: Energy Optimization, Intelligent Control Systems, and Predictive Operational Safety.
Traditional hydraulic systems run constant-speed motors that dump excess hydraulic oil back to reservoirs, wasting substantial heat and energy. Our latest OEM Heavy Duty Extrusion lines use smart servo-driven pump systems. By matching motor speeds to the exact dynamic requirements of each phase (rapid descent, pressing, dwell, and return), we reduce electricity consumption by up to 50% while lowering oil cooling requirements.
Platen parallelism is critical during high-tonnage strokes. Off-center loads can damage tooling and lead to inconsistent part dimensions. Jiangdong Machinery integrates multi-cylinder leveling systems driven by high-response proportional cartridge valves. Real-time optical encoders measure positioning variations down to the micron scale, and the main controller automatically adjusts oil flow to individual cylinders to maintain flatness under uneven forming loads.
Each hydraulic press line can be integrated with a digital twin virtual model. Standard industrial sensors monitor temperature, pressure, vibration, and oil quality. This sensor data is analyzed using edge computing algorithms to predict component degradation (such as valve wear or seal breakdown) before it causes downtime. Operating parameters are visible locally and via secure remote connections, ensuring plant managers stay informed.

To meet strict emissions targets and optimize electric vehicle ranges, automakers are shifting to high-strength steels, aluminum alloys, and carbon composites. Our integrated hot stamping lines, hydroforming systems, and LFT-D setups help automotive OEMs produce complex structural components with optimal strength-to-weight ratios.
Aerospace components require high manufacturing precision. Our superplastic forming (SPF) and isothermal forging presses operate with precise speed and temperature controls. These systems are used to shape complex titanium alloy wing skins, jet engine blades, and structural bulkheads without internal material stresses.
From high-pressure industrial hydrogen storage vessels to domestic fire extinguishers, our horizontal and vertical gas cylinder drawing production lines run automated cycles. These systems handle raw metal billets, perform multi-stage deep drawing, neck the cylinder dome, and run quality checks on finished vessels.
